Quality Assessment
As of 01 February 2026, Kalpataru Ltd’s quality grade is assessed as below average. The company operates with a notably high debt burden, reflected in an average Debt to Equity ratio of 6.84 times. Such leverage levels increase financial risk, especially in a sector like realty where cash flows can be cyclical and sensitive to economic conditions. Furthermore, the company’s average Return on Equity (ROE) stands at a mere 0.44%, signalling limited profitability relative to shareholders’ funds. This low ROE suggests that the company is generating minimal returns on invested capital, which is a concern for long-term value creation.
Valuation Considerations
Kalpataru Ltd is currently classified as expensive based on valuation metrics. The company’s Return on Capital Employed (ROCE) is a low 0.2%, yet it trades at an Enterprise Value to Capital Employed ratio of 1.2. This disparity indicates that investors are paying a premium for capital that is not generating commensurate returns. Despite the stock’s flat price performance over the past year, with a 0.00% return, the company’s profits have risen by 123%, which may reflect some operational improvements. However, the elevated valuation relative to returns raises questions about the sustainability of this profit growth and whether it justifies the current market price.
Financial Trend and Performance
The financial trend for Kalpataru Ltd is characterised as flat, indicating a lack of significant improvement or deterioration in recent periods. The company reported flat results in the quarter ending September 2025, with a notable anomaly where non-operating income accounted for 457.95% of Profit Before Tax (PBT). This suggests that core business operations are under pressure, and profits are being supported by non-recurring or ancillary income sources. Over the past six months, the stock has declined by 10.54%, and over three months by 12.25%, reflecting investor concerns about the company’s earnings quality and growth prospects. Year-to-date, the stock has marginally gained 0.61%, but this modest increase does not offset the broader negative trend.

Stock Returns and Market Movement
As of 01 February 2026, the stock has shown mixed returns over various time frames. It gained 2.09% on the most recent trading day and 1.32% over the past week, indicating some short-term buying interest. However, the one-month return is negative at -2.95%, and the three-month return is down by 12.25%. These figures highlight a weakening trend over the medium term. The six-month decline of 10.54% further emphasises the challenges faced by the company in maintaining investor confidence. The year-to-date gain of 0.61% is modest and does not signal a strong recovery.
